A high-pressure container liquid level detection method based on normal-pressure instruments
By designing a transparent pressure-blocking cover and a sensor mounting plate, combined with a laser rangefinder, the problem of conventional instruments being unable to work in high-pressure environments was solved, enabling atmospheric pressure measurement of the liquid level in high-pressure containers and ensuring equipment safety and stable production.

[0001] This invention belongs to the field of liquid level detection technology, specifically relating to a method for detecting the liquid level of a high-pressure vessel based on an atmospheric pressure instrument. Background Technology
[0002] In production and daily life, high-pressure gas storage tanks are commonly used to store compressed gases such as liquefied petroleum gas (LPG), liquefied natural gas (LNG), and oxygen. Liquid level measurement is a crucial step in monitoring and controlling the height of the liquid or gas within the storage tank. The accuracy and stability of liquid level measurement are essential for the safe operation of the storage tank. Accurate monitoring of the liquid level in high-pressure gas storage tanks helps prevent overfilling or over-draining, avoiding abnormal increases or decreases in internal pressure, thus ensuring the safe operation of the storage tank. Simultaneously, in some industrial production processes, liquid level measurement in storage tanks can be used to monitor and control the supply of raw materials, ensuring the stability and continuity of the production process. For energy reserves such as LPG and LNG, liquid level measurement helps to monitor and manage the storage capacity in the tank in real time, ensuring the stability of the energy supply.
[0003] High-voltage measuring instruments are complex and costly, while conventional instruments are relatively simple and inexpensive, but they cannot function properly under high-voltage conditions. Firstly, measurements under high voltage require consideration of the impact of high voltage on the instrument's structure; high voltage places higher demands on the instrument's sealing performance, mechanical stability, and pressure resistance. Therefore, to ensure the normal operation of conventional instruments under high-voltage conditions, special sealing structures and materials must be used. Summary of the Invention
[0004] In view of this, the purpose of this invention is to provide a method for detecting the liquid level of a high-pressure vessel based on an atmospheric pressure instrument. This invention aims to solve the problem that conventional liquid level measuring instruments are limited by high pressure and cannot directly measure the liquid level of high-pressure vessels.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, the present invention provides a method for detecting the liquid level of a high-pressure vessel based on an atmospheric pressure instrument, comprising the following steps:
[0006] S1. Design a transparent pressure-isolating cover plate based on optical performance and gas pressure inside the high-pressure vessel;
[0007] S2. A measuring channel is set on the high-pressure vessel, the measuring channel is perpendicular to the liquid surface inside the high-pressure vessel, and a float is installed in the measuring channel;
[0008] S3. Design the sensor mounting plate based on the measurement channel and the pressure isolation cover;
[0009] S4. Install the sensor mounting plate onto the high-pressure vessel using the flange and second bolts, with the center of the sensor mounting plate facing the measurement channel.
[0010] S5. Install the pressure-isolating cover plate onto the sensor mounting plate using the first bolt;
[0011] S6. Place a laser rangefinder on the pressure-isolating cover plate, with the pulse emitting end of the laser rangefinder facing the center of the measurement channel;
[0012] S7. Install an instrument cover on the outside of the laser rangefinder sensor;
[0013] S8. Activate the laser rangefinder sensor to detect the liquid level inside the high-pressure container.

[0100] The detection principle of this invention is as follows: Figure 1 As shown: The pressure vessel contains the liquid to be tested. A measuring channel 12 is installed within the pressure vessel, and a float is placed inside the measuring channel 12. The float moves up and down with the liquid level, reflecting the liquid level in real time. A sensor mounting plate 9 is installed on the pressure vessel, and is fixedly connected to the pressure vessel via a flange 2 and a second bolt 8. A through hole is pre-drilled in the middle of the sensor mounting plate 9, facing the center of the measuring channel 12. The top of the sensor mounting plate 9 adopts a recessed structure, and a pressure isolation cover 4 is mounted on the sensor mounting plate 9 in a fitted manner via a first bolt 7. A laser rangefinder sensor 5 is placed in the center of the transparent pressure isolation cover 4. The pulse emitting end of the laser rangefinder sensor 5 faces the center of the measuring channel 12. The laser rangefinder sensor 5 emits pulses from the measuring channel 12 and receives echoes, achieving non-contact measurement and ensuring that the laser rangefinder sensor 5 operates normally under normal pressure, isolating the pressure vessel from the high-pressure environment. An instrument cover 6 is installed outside the sensors to ensure the normal operation of each sensor and to provide protection.
